Steps to make Wiltshire White Chocolate Blondie:
  1. Preheat oven to 160°C. Grease brownie pan & line the base and two long sides with baking paper. Wiltshire blondies pic & pan below. (Idea to decorate/garnish)
  2. Melt A in a medium saucepan over low heat. Stir until well combined. Set aside to cool slightly.
  3. Prepare B.
  4. Sift C.
  5. Stir in C (in batches), B into A until well combined. Pour into prepared pan. Bake for 45mins or until a skewer inserted in the center comes out clean. Oven 160°C. Adjust oven temperature/heat accordingly. Cool in pan
  6. White Chocolate Ganache - place cream in a small saucepan over medium low heat. Bring to just below the boil & pour over the chocolate in a heatproof bowl. Allow to sit for 5min before stirring until smooth. Place in the fridge for 30mins, stirring every 10mins until spreadable.
  7. Place blondie on a serving platter, spread over the ganache & decorate with strawberries & rose petal. Or simple spread Ganache over sliced Blondie.
